Is mold of any use?
Of course it is. Going through food spoiling nature some of your must have developed an idea on molds as a most detrimental fungi. But it is not true as the molds still produce multitude of foods stimulating an appetite among the people for variety of savory dishes. Utilized as cultured molds, these mildews produce cheese, tempeh, oncom, quorn, toasts/bread, sausages, soy sauce, etc. Koji is a most crucial mold which plays its centric role in producing the soybean paste and soy sauce, preferred all over the world. It is unique fermentation process which mixes the wheat and soybean with each other, preparing in this way a widely preferred food product. Apart from producing soybean sauce and soybean paste, the Koji mold produces distilled spirit as well by disintegrating the starch of rice. Another crucial mold, grown commercially on rice is known as the red rice yeast, preferred all over the world as healthy diet. The red rice yeast is beneficial for the cardiac patients as almost all the products of red rice yeast prepared in fish oil lower a cholesterol level in the body and checks a fast heartbeat as well.
Symptoms of mold allergy
The people residing in a hot humid climatic conditions or affected from mold emergence encounter some critical conditions, treated as the symptoms of mold allergy. Some of common allergic symptoms of molds are itching in the eyes, coughing, headache, weakness, fatigue, sinus problem, relentless sneezing and nasal chocking. Though avoiding a hot humid place is the only way to keep mold allergy at bay, some remedial steps also can treat the mold allergic reaction.

Prevention for the allergic molds
- Keep your house clean and dry.
- There are many mold inhibitors available in the market in the form of liquid and powder. Use such mold-preventing sprays, sprinkling it on curtains, books, furniture, sofa, mattresses, mats and foamed pillows. Spray the mold inhibitor on bathtub, geyser, tiles of walls and doors of bathroom as well. Besides, the kitchen also should be immunized with mold killing substances.
- Paint your interior house by mixing mold inhibitor in your preferred color or paint. Besides, you should preferably use the linoleum on carpet of bathroom during the renovation of your house.
- Keep your bathroom dry by removing all the moisture thereof through exhaust fan. Keeping the bathroom free from moisture prevents the mold allergy symptoms.
